视频: 2. 异步编程里的一些基本术语解释 2024
C#的一部分5. 0一体化傻瓜作弊表
很多Windows 8是关于快速和流畅。这样做的方法是在长时间运行的功能的回调中使用异步方法。问题在于,在C#中,实现异步方法的最好方法是使用线程。但是,不能总是依赖于线程操作的项目何时回来。如果你希望用户能够感觉到有一些控制,就需要有一些控制。
<! - 1 - >输入异步并等待。异步是用来声明一个异步函数,它返回一个任务。所有的异步方法必须至少包含一个await表达式。等待告诉C#采用引用的代码,并在与用户线程不同的线程中运行它。该表分解了该语言的新异步部分。
语句 | 描述 |
---|---|
async | 一个修饰符,显示编译器它
修改的函数是异步的。 |
await | 在等待完成的任务完成之前暂停执行包含
方法的运算符。 |
任务 | 表示一个异步操作。 |
任务 | 返回值的异步操作。 |
任务。 ContinueWith | 在任务
中的操作完成后开始的延续。 |